WebAug 5, 2024 · Butcher block counters are sanitary once they are properly sealed. If left unsealed, they will absorb germs and bacteria and will be unsafe for food preparation. Properly sealed, they are perfectly safe and sanitary for food prep. They do need to be resealed regularly. What kind of wood is used for butcher block countertops? WebMar 18, 2024 · Edge grain butcher block is much more common for countertops, with the sides of the wood placed up against each other. It's a softer, more neutral look. A face grain design is made with wider planks of wood face up side by side. lymphatic pronounce

WebJul 13, 2024 · Butcher block countertops are made from straight cuts of wood that are glued together. The thick slabs offer a sturdy and smooth surface for food preparation. While they’re usually found in commercial … WebDec 18, 2024 · What wood is used for butcher blocks? Most butcher blocks are made of hardwood such as maple, cherry, oak, or walnut. Butcher blocks are usually sold unfinished. This means that you will need to stain or paint the surface yourself. Are wooden butcher blocks sanitary?
